Pinnacles Hut

Pinnacles Hut is a wilderness hut in , and has an elevation of 900 metres. Pinnacles Hut is situated nearby to the peak , as well as near .

Peak
Mount Somers / Te Kiekie is a mountain in the of New Zealand, located in the foothills of the . At 1,688 metres, it is prominently visible from the .
